			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>People who have suffered with back pain for years have always looked into alternative treatments to find relief.  One of these alternative treatments that have been very successful in reducing back pain is practicing yoga.  Over time, yoga can increase the strength and flexibility of your back muscles, and can counteract the tightness and weak muscles that can cause many types of back pain.  Before practicing yoga, it may be a good idea to consult your doctor beforehand, to see if yoga is appropriate for you and your condition.</p>
<p>Using yoga to relieve back pain is no longer a theory, or an idea without merit, it is a reality.  Yoga is now accepted by most back care specialists as an effective treatment, and even sometimes, a remedy for the relief of back pain.  Practicing yoga will give you proper lumbar and back support, while at the same time strengthening the muscles in your back.  Practicing yoga over time will also help to realign your posture, which can also be a cause of back pain in itself.  Not only that, but yoga is also soothing, meditative, and healing to your body.</p>
<p>Many physicians will instruct patients with back problems to engage in some form of physical activity, or exercise to strengthen their back muscles, and to reduce overall pain.  However, many exercises can wreak havoc on an already aching back, and too much rigorous exercise can actually exacerbate the condition.  Traditional Western exercise tends to be very taxing on the body, especially the back, and although exercise is needed, the wrong kind of exercise can be ruinous for people with back problems.  This is one reason why yoga can be so beneficial in treating people that suffer from back pain.    </p>
<p>Yoga has been practiced for thousands of years and there is a reason why.  Because it works.  Yoga has been well known for a long time to increase flexibility, strength, circulation, and help regulate breathing.  But it has not been until recently that doctors have made the connection between yoga and treating back pain.  Not only does this seem like a natural marriage, but it is also an effective one. </p>
<p>The first thing you want to do after consulting your doctor is contact a few yoga instructors and tell them about your condition.  They will be able to effectively guide you to what are the best movements for your condition, and give you a plan so that you will be successful.  Yoga can be an excellent way to relieve back pain and keep it from controlling and ruining your life.  But it&#8217;s critical to find the right instructor that challenges you, but understands your condition, and has experience training others with similar back problems.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Yoga, an exotic form of exercise, is now the new trend in the fitness world. Just like any other form of exercise, it is based on basic philosophies in order to attain a healthy body and mind for its practitioners.</p>
<p>The following details will discuss the five yoga principles and how they may be of help to our exercise. </p>
<p>1. Relaxation &#8211; this yoga principle involves proper relaxation that can help release muscle tensions. This works by putting the mind and body in a tranquil state, which is the goal of yoga. This revitalizes the nervous system and lets us achieve inner peace. This makes each day of our life feels so complete and peaceful. The relaxed feeling is carried into all our activities that help us conserve energy in our body.</p>
<p>2. Proper diet &#8211; the food we eat greatly affects the way we think. Improper nutrition can sometimes cause mental inefficiency and hinder our capabilities to achieve self-awareness. A healthy diet should be able to nourish both the mind and the body. However, this does not necessarily mean that we have to eat all the healthy foods we come across every day. We should also learn to eat in moderations to prevent any food related ailments. Eat only when you are hungry.</p>
<p>3. Correct breathing &#8211; this next yoga principle involves can be achieved though deep, slow and regular breathing. Correct breathing utilizes all part of the lungs to increase oxygen intake. To achieve this we need to regulate the duration and length of inhaling, exhaling and retaining air in our lungs. In yoga practice, each breath is known to contain our life force and that through proper breathing; we can maintain our over-all wellness.</p>
<p>4. Proper exercise &#8211; this yoga principle is based upon the idea that our physical body is designed to move and exercise. The correct form of exercise in yoga is achieved through different form of postures and stretches. These exercises tone our muscles, regulate blood flow and enhance the flexibility of our spine. Yoga poses, also known as Asnas, works in partner with correct breathing. Each pose and stretch should be coordinated with a correct form of breathing allowing us to feel one with our body and spirit.</p>
<p>5. Meditation and positive thinking &#8211; meditation can relax the mind and the body. It also helps remove negative thoughts from our mind. Thus, purifying us from stress and other worldly thoughts that we might have.</p>
<p>For those who want to begin the yoga practice, just keep in mind these yoga principles so that you will not be mislead from your true goal. That is to attain a healthy mind and body.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We may have been practicing yoga for quite some time now, but to understand it better we have to look further into its origins and roots. An overview on yoga history will help us appreciate the yoga tradition better. Although, some researchers say that yoga dated as early as the first Indian civilizations, there is no proof to this. </p>
<p>Yoga history has traces in some Indian religions. In Hinduism, Shamanism, Jainism and Buddhism yoga means spiritual discipline. The earliest sign of a yoga practice can be seen in Shamanism. Both yoga and shamanism has similar goals that focus on the effort to improve the state of body and mind. Another similarity they both have is that they try to improve the overall health conditions of each member. However, this does not mean that to practice yoga is to enter a new religion. Yoga is for all and is universal. No matter what are your beliefs, you can still practice yoga. </p>
<p>Yoga history has also left some solid clues or hints behind like artifacts and documents depicting yoga postures. After a careful study, researchers have found out that these items dates back in 3000 B.C.</p>
<p>In the oldest existing text, the Rig-veda, has evidences that it utilize some yoga principles. Rig-veda is compilation of hymns that include prayers for divine harmony and greater being. Rig-veda is the sacred scripture of Brahmanism that is the basis of present day Hinduism. It also contains the oldest known yogic teachings.</p>
<p>During the time of Brahmanism, the yoga practice is now widely used by Vedic people or Vedas followers. This is the clear part of the yoga history. Vedas followers rely on to dedicated Vedic Yogis to help them live in divine harmony.</p>
<p>Later on, practice for experiencing greater state of consciousness is improved by the traditions of Upanishads. During the 6th century B.C., a Buddhist prince studied yoga and achieved enlightenment at the age of 35. He is now known as Buddha or the enlightened one. At 5th century B.C., a yoga scripture was created and known as Bhagavad-Gita or the Lord&#8217;s song. This scripture is dedicated entirely to yoga and includes some yoga history information that tells us that it has already been an ancient practice, even before the creation of the Bhagavad-Gita.</p>
<p>The creation of the Yoga Sutra marks the classical period of yoga history. It defines and standardizes classical yoga. From this, we can find eight underlying principles of yoga and these are:</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>In Tantra Yoga the physical well being of person who practices it gets boosted. In Tantra yoga a person needs to be totally committed and it is this commitment which forms the basis of the yoga. People who practice this kind of yoga are called tantriks.  These people not only worship their own body but will go to any lengths to attain occult powers. </p>
<p>This form of yoga is not in practice among most people in India today though it was widely practiced by some adepts living in certain parts of the country and those living in the high mountains of the Himalayas. </p>
<p>The origins of Tantra yoga still remains a mystery to many people. Researchers believe that it was the Pre-Aryans who were the founders of this system of yoga but still others are of the opinion that the origins of this yoga are attributed to the early men. This yoga is said to have been in existence around the same time as Buddhism. It is because of this that some of the Tantrik symbols and signs have been used by the Buddhists. </p>
<p>It was much later that this yoga actually became a separate group. Tantras are similar to the Vedas and are a collection of poetic verses. Here there is elaborate description of the various methods on proper worship and love of the divine.</p>
<p>Most of the verses are vague and difficult to understand y the layman so most people find it rather spiritual and think they are meant only for those who practice the tanrtik rituals. The people who practice Tantra yoga are known as Sadhaks and they normally lead a life of utter simplicity. For them their very practice is prayer. These people are found meditating in lonely and secluded places far away from the reaches of society. They can be distinguished and recognized only through the robes they wear and the begging bowl that they carry. Sometimes they are also found selling medicinal herbs, shells, and trinkets.</p>
<p>There is another facet to Tantra yoga also where the yogi or sadhak performs a number of difficult austerities using his body. In Tantra Yoga sex and love making are given importance and is widely practiced by those following this system of yoga. </p>
<p>Many who practice this yoga believe that to achieve siddhi or supernatural powers one has to awaken the dormant Kundalini or serpent power. Practice of a certain type of meditation can awaken this serpent power. It is believed that constant and arduous practice of this particular meditation causes the serpent to gradually uncoil and rise very slowly. The uncoiled serpent energy then slowly begins to rise through the spin. Once awakened it is believed that tremendous energy is released which causes the skin to feel hot and sweat begins to flow profusely till the person experiences a stinging feeling.  This practice is extremely dangerous as it can also destroy the person totally if this meditation is not performed with caution and under strict supervision. The sadhak experiences sensational pleasure when the energy touches its peak. The person becomes a sage or Sadhu on achieving this state.
